Programs of Scale Grant

The Programs of Scale grant application process opens June 1st. The Trustees of The Rotary Foundation implemented this relatively new grant to increase our impact through programs of scale: large, high-impact projects that attract exceptional partners while making the most of the capacity, expertise, and enthusiasm of our members.

What project in your club or district has evidence of success and is ready to scale way up? The first step in this process is to submit concept notes. Both qualified Rotary and Rotaract clubs and districts may submit these between June 1st and August 1st, through 23:59 Central Time. The concept notes should summarize programs and projects that are evidence-based and ready to scale over three to five years in partnership with other organizations. The Programs of Scale website page will have a link to the application starting on June 1st.
